In a significant move signaling growing institutional interest in cryptocurrency, BlackRock has transferred over 3,000 Bitcoin to Coinbase Prime. This action highlights the increasing reliance on digital assets and the infrastructure supporting them, particularly for its iShares Bitcoin Trust, and the publication demonstrates positive momentum in the developments.
Strong Demand from Institutional Investors
The transfer of 3,143 BTC underscores the strong demand from institutional investors, as BlackRock continues to position itself at the forefront of the crypto market. This strategic move not only facilitates operations for its Bitcoin Trust but also reflects a broader trend of institutional adoption in the cryptocurrency space.
